WATER TEMPERATURE PRICING
The washer can be set for different levels of pricing for Cold, Warm and Hot water. The Cold
water setting is considered as the base price, which is the normal washer cycle price.
Stage 4: Warm Water Price – The next step in the pricing program is to set the additional price
for Warm water usage. The additional price is the amount added to the price of a cold wash. The
display will blink first "CH P" indicating cold/hot water mix price and then "00.00". To change
the value, use the Hot temperature button to decrease and the Warm temperature button to
increase. The value will change in 1¢ steps. The range of values is from $00.00 to $99.99.
Note: To not use this feature, set the price to "00.00".
When the desired price is displayed, push the Start button once to store the new value and a
second time to move to the next Coin/Price programming step. To exit the Coin/Price
programming mode, push the Cold temperature button for 5 seconds.
Stage 5: Hot Water Price – The next step in the pricing program is to set the additional price for
Hot water usage. The additional price is the amount added to the price of a cold wash. The
display will blink first "H P" indicating hot water price and then "00.00". To change the value,
use the Hot temperature button to decrease and the Warm temperature button to increase. The
value will change in 1¢ steps. The range of values is from $00.00 to $99.99.
Note: To not use this feature, set the price to "00.00".
When the desired price is displayed, push the Start button once to store the new value and a
second time to move to the next Coin/Price programming step. To exit the Coin/Price
programming mode, push the Cold temperature button for 5 seconds. The Coin/Price
programming mode will automatically exit and return to the Idle mode if no buttons are pushed
for one minute.
Stage 6: Plus Cycle Price -- The next step in the programming sequence is the Plus Cycle
feature. The Plus Cycle adds three (3) minutes of wash time to the wash bath only. The
controller can be programmed to charge a fee for this or the feature can be turned off. The
default setting is off. To turn the Plus Cycle feature off, set the Plus Cycle price to zero.
The display will blink first a "PC P" indicating Plus Cycle price and then price (back and forth).
To change the value, use the Hot temperature button to decrease and the Warm temperature
button to increase. The value will change in 1¢ steps. The range of values is from $00.00 to
$99.99. When the desired price is displayed, push the Start temperature button once to store the
new value and a second time to move to the next Coin/Price programming step. To exit the
Coin/Price programming mode, push the Cold temperature button for 5 seconds.
Stage 7: Decimal Point -- The next step in the programming sequence is the decimal point
display. The display will start blinking back and forth first "dP " (Decimal Point) and then either
"on" (default) or "off". Press the Hot or Warm temperature buttons to select the decimal point
display as "on" or "off". When the desired setting is displayed, push the Start button to store it
and a second time to move to the next programming step.
